This place should be a must-visit—a lively tribute to Malaysia’s greatest entertainer. Instead, it’s a bit of a letdown, saved only by nostalgia and the fact that it’s free.

First, the good: the house itself is a well-preserved slice of old Malaya. A replica of where the man was born, it’s filled with artefacts—some original, some not. Walk barefoot across the creaky wooden floors, peek into the modest bedroom, the kitchen with its vintage utensils. For those who grew up on his films and songs, there’s a quiet thrill in standing where he once did.

Now, the bad. Expect to finish the whole tour in under an hour. Parking is a nightmare: narrow roads, limited spaces. There’s nothing to take home except blurry phone pics. No DVDs, no music, no souvenir shop, no café—just a dusty display case of missed opportunities.

But if you love P. Ramlee, you’ll shrug and go anyway. Just don’t expect a world-class museum—expect a time capsule that’s half-forgotten, much like how Malaysia treats its...

Highly recommended for fans of P. Ramlee, Malaysian cinema buffs, or anyone curious about local cultural history. It offers an intimate atmosphere and a curated journey through the life of a national icon. If time is limited, it’s a meaningful stop you can easily fit into a half-day itinerary in Penang.

The building is the restored wooden kampung house where P. Ramlee was born in 1926, now lovingly maintained by the National Archives .

Though he didn't live there permanently, the house retains an authentic historical feel—nipah thatched roof, polished timber floors and original rooms like the living room, kitchen, bedroom, and even his bicycle and sampan .

Free entry, open Tues–Sun (~9 am–5 pm; Fri brief closure 12–3 pm; closed Mondays unless public holiday) .

Most visitors spend 30–60 minutes exploring .

Small in size—can be fully explored in ~30 minutes if you're just browsing.

Minimal interactive elements; suggestions include guided tours or workshops to boost...
